Here’s a succinct guide to verifying the safety of your canned goods:

Inspect the can for any visible damage, such as bulging, rusting, or leaks.

Be cautious of any unusual odors or alterations in appearance and texture upon opening.

When in doubt, prioritize safety and dispose of the questionable product.

Maximizing Shelf Life: Storage Essentials

Upholding the longevity and safety of your canned goods entails adhering to effective storage practices:

Store in a cool, dry, and sunlight-free environment.

Position cans upright to safeguard their seals.
